Lost Writing
I lost so much writing in September 2021.
I started doing this in January 2021, when COVID was starting to feel like a joke and I could feel the rest of my life slipping away. I started typing to myself in my room in Los Angeles every night for no reason at all.
One day, 6 months later, in one of my my most epic personal blunders, all of my writing was vaporized instantly. I use the Notes App to write everything. And for some reason, when I unchecked a box in System Preferences which said “Sync to all devices,” every single note saved on my laptop and nowhere else was suddenly and permanently gone.
I paid no mind at first. Surely, it can’t be this easy to delete so many notes. Surely Apple has some kind of protection in place for someone like me who has made a home for themselves on the Notes app. Surely there is some kind of guard rail for dopes like me with no back up. There was no such guard rail.
I was distraught. I wrote a note about it. I pathetically messaged one of the big “vulnerable” writing guys I was inspired by on twitter. He enjoys a medium level of internet fame. He replied to me. He told me to keep writing. You’ll replace it in no time. I didn’t need his advice. I was addicted then and I am addicted now. It’s not a choice any more.
